Incorporating Louisiana CorporationsWhat is a Louisiana corporation?Louisiana corporations are separate legal entities established by the shareholders. The shareholders elect to have an incorporator make the action to incorporate a Louisiana corporation to create a separate entity from them personally. How much do Louisiana corporations cost?A Louisiana corporation will cost $60 to file the articles of incorporation How to form Louisiana corporations:You have to file the articles of incorporation and an initial report with the LA Secretary of State. It will take about a week to process your LA corporation articles of incorporation. You can mail, fax, or walk in the LA articles of incorporation form or you can file online. Louisiana Secretary of State has a couple of expedited processing options. If you pay a $30 fee they will process in 24 hours. If you file in person and pay a $50 fee, the SOS will process while you wait. If you need a federal tax ID number, that can be obtained online immediately with the IRS. How are Louisiana corporations regulated?Louisiana Corporations are governed by Louisiana Code - Title 12 Corporations and Associations. Louisiana corporations require:Articles of Incorporation:
